Scaling Context Matters
David emphasizes the importance of adapting business practices and code to fit the scale of the company, arguing that advice from large corporations often doesn't apply to smaller teams. He acknowledges the challenge of assuming that his experiences are universally relevant and highlights the need for flexibility in planning for future growth. Stefan raises the question of whether it's better to address problems as they arise or to anticipate future challenges, particularly in technology and architecture.In this clip
